Starting an at-home workout routine can be incredibly rewarding, especially when paired with outdoor challenges like a 45-minute uphill climb. From personal experience, working out at home allows you to focus on strength, flexibility, and cardio without the distractions of a busy gym. Adding a rigorous uphill climb afterwards significantly increases cardiovascular endurance and leg strength, offering a well-rounded fitness session. To maximize benefits during your at-home workout, focus on compound movements such as squats, lunges, push-ups, and core exercises. These engage multiple muscle groups efficiently and prepare your body better for demanding activities like climbing. Additionally, consistency is key — planning your sessions several times a week helps build stamina gradually. When tackling the uphill climb, proper pacing and breathing techniques are crucial. Start at a sustainable speed to keep your heart rate steady, and use deep, controlled breaths to maintain oxygen flow. Wearing supportive footwear and hydrated adequately will also improve performance and prevent injuries. This combined approach, of indoor workouts complemented by natural terrain cardio, keeps fitness routines exciting and results-driven. It's a lifestyle-friendly method that has helped many gym enthusiasts stay motivated while building strength, endurance, and mental toughness.
